Service Due Soon B1 For Your Honda Odyssey

Your Honda odyssey is equipped with an algorithm-based system that tells you when your vehicle needs maintenance. That system is called the Maintenance Minder.

When your B1 service alert comes up, it means that it’s time to get an oil change. This is a relatively routine service, but it’s still important to get it taken care of.

Oil Change

Honda service is an important part of maintaining your vehicle. The Maintenance Minder system will alert you when it’s time for oil changes, tire rotations, and other services.

If your Honda odyssey service due soon b1 shows up on your dashboard, this means it’s time for an oil change and a mechanical inspection. In addition, the B1 display will tell you that a tire rotation is also needed.

A dirty engine won’t properly lubricate its components, which can lead to serious damage. In order to avoid this, schedule an oil change as soon as you notice the B1 light appearing on your dash.

Your Honda Odyssey’s engine requires synthetic motor oil, which is generally changed every 7,500 to 10,000 miles. Talk with your technician about the best oil for your vehicle.

Tire Rotation

When you get a B1 service due soon alert from your Honda maintenance minder, it means that you are due for an oil change and tire rotation. That’s a fairly significant requirement, but it isn’t that time-consuming or expensive so you won’t have to put off getting it done!

Typically, it’s recommended that you have an oil change and tire rotation every 5,000 to 7,500 miles. However, the Maintenance Minder system will adjust your needs based on the life of your oil.

That’s why it’s important to have these services taken care of soon after you notice the b1 alert so you don’t have to wait until your next 1,000 mile check-up or even worse, until you hit the 7,500 mile mark!

Keeping your tires in top condition is also crucial to driving safely and improving your fuel economy. By ensuring that your tires have even tread wear and are not over or underinflated, you can increase your Honda’s longevity and improve its handling for smoother and more stable ride quality.
